| Форум РадиоКот https://radiokot.ru/forum/ |
|
| Pickit2 не прошивает PIC16F690 https://radiokot.ru/forum/viewtopic.php?f=58&t=98907 |
Страница 1 из 1 |
| Автор: | Demo65 [ Вс янв 05, 2014 02:25:25 ] |
| Заголовок сообщения: | Pickit2 не прошивает PIC16F690 |
Уважаемые, сделал ампервольтметр с сайта http://vrtp.ru/index.php?showtopic=14164&st=0 надо прошить контроллер, имеется программатор Pickit2, прошивал им не раз микроконтроллеры, косяков не было. Теперь решил прошить PIC16F690, программатор всё определяет как и обычно, шьёт, стирает контроллер, но прошивка не заливается в контроллер, хотя программатор показал. что залил. Начинаю после прошивки читать контроллер, там все 0000!? Калибровка в норме, на VPP 12.3V, тест программатор проходит на ура. В чём дело не пойму. Другой контроллер такой же вставил, стирает, но не заливает прошивку. Верификация тоже не проходит, пишет 0х000000. |
|
| Автор: | otest [ Вс янв 05, 2014 10:27:04 ] |
| Заголовок сообщения: | Re: Pickit2 не прошивает PIC16F690 |
Выкладывай НЕХ и скрин конфигурации. По такому сообщению можно только посочувствовать. |
|
| Автор: | Demo65 [ Вс янв 05, 2014 10:30:07 ] | |||||
| Заголовок сообщения: | Re: Pickit2 не прошивает PIC16F690 | |||||
Выложил hex, не понял. скрины каких настроек? сейчас и ExtraPic попробовал прошить, пишет -Ошибка-> Адрес проверки 0х000000 В буфере:0х3002 Реально в чипе:0х0000. Проверил сам программатор, тесты проходит, замерил все напряжения на панельке контроллера. всё в порядке, всё включается и отключается, взял несколько контроллеров других марок, прошил, стёр, всё на ура! Ни каких косяков. А вот 690, напрочь отказывается шить.
|
||||||
| Автор: | КРАМ [ Вс янв 05, 2014 12:32:52 ] |
| Заголовок сообщения: | Re: Pickit2 не прошивает PIC16F690 |
Конфигурационное слово 0x039C Из чего следует, что MCLR использован как вход. Установите галку в меню Tools-Use Vpp first Program Entry. |
|
| Автор: | Demo65 [ Вс янв 05, 2014 12:38:09 ] |
| Заголовок сообщения: | Re: Pickit2 не прошивает PIC16F690 |
установил галку, толку нет. Прошивка не залилась. Исходник поищу, может на сайте автора есть. Взял другую прошивку с того же сайта, тоже не залил. |
|
| Автор: | КРАМ [ Вс янв 05, 2014 12:43:34 ] |
| Заголовок сообщения: | Re: Pickit2 не прошивает PIC16F690 |
Залилась прошивка или нет - Вы не узнаете, если не запустите контроллер. У Вас прошивка залочена и прочитать ее невозможно. Будут читаться одни нули. Непрошитый контроллер читается как единицы (3FFF) |
|
| Автор: | Demo65 [ Вс янв 05, 2014 12:45:52 ] |
| Заголовок сообщения: | Re: Pickit2 не прошивает PIC16F690 |
Хорошо, согласен, сейчас скачал прошивку с венгерского с ESR и попробовал залить, тоже самое.Тоже залочена? пишет опять -верификация 0х000000 Хотя может вы и правы, скачал ещё прошивку с венгерского ESR, залил, программатор показал, что прошивка залита, на самом деле одни 0 , прочитал прошивку, включил верификацию, та показала. что всё путём. Вопрос. можно проверить логическим анализатором Pickit этот контроллер и как? По вашему совету, буду в железе проверять, чтобы себе и вам голову не забивать. Спасибо за подсказку КРАМ!!! Всё прошивается, просто точно прошивка залочена и не даёт читать её, а я всю голову изломал. Век живи - век учись!!!
|
|
| Автор: | otest [ Вс янв 05, 2014 16:55:53 ] |
| Заголовок сообщения: | Re: Pickit2 не прошивает PIC16F690 |
Вот НЕХ без защиты. Всё будет считываться. |
|
| Автор: | Demo65 [ Вс янв 05, 2014 17:16:44 ] |
| Заголовок сообщения: | Re: Pickit2 не прошивает PIC16F690 |
Спасибо!!! сейчас посмотрим1 ![]() Ну вот, так привычнее, всё видно, что записал!!! Ещё раз Огромное спасибо!!! |
|
| Автор: | КРАМ [ Вс янв 05, 2014 18:23:40 ] |
| Заголовок сообщения: | Re: Pickit2 не прошивает PIC16F690 |
Вы вообще напрасно верифицируете прошивку. Она и так проверяется при программировании, а лишь потом лочится. Я не сразу понял что Вы делаете это дополнительно... Получили зеленый фон после прошивки - значит все ОК. |
|
| Автор: | Demo65 [ Вс янв 05, 2014 18:26:17 ] |
| Заголовок сообщения: | Re: Pickit2 не прошивает PIC16F690 |
Спасибо, я затупил немного. по этому и делал верификацию, надо было бы мне смотреть при прошивки контроллера что программатор делает. |
|
| Страница 1 из 1 | Часовой пояс: UTC + 3 часа |
|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group http://www.phpbb.com/ |
|


